Transportation: Buses to Senglea

    Getting TO/AROUND: The current fare (Valletta-Senglea) is 20 cents (= EUR 0.47) for adults and 15 cents (EUR 0.35) for children. The bus to board is bus number 3, with a full timetable available at the Valletta terminus.

    Buses start at 06:00 (Mon to Sat) or 07:30 (Sun) and operate at 30-minute intervals (on the hour and half-hour) until 22:00 (Mon to Fri). The journey should take around 20 minutes, but be aware that two routes exist, both of which start at Valletta terminus and end at Senglea terminus.

    Circular routes operate in summer. In 2006, bus 22 operated the Senglea-Marsascala circular, starting at 08:15 in Senglea and finishing at 22:30 in Marsascala. Frequencies vary, but are mostly hourly on the half hour. This is subject to demand however and timetables may vary withour prior notice - it is best to check on the day you intend to use the service.

    Transportation: Boats to Senglea

    Getting TO/AROUND: A second way of entering Senglea is by boat, from across the harbour in Vittoriosa. Pricing tends to be creative, but last time I took the boat (August 2006) it was around EUR 7.00 for the trip (irrelevant of the number of people that do board). The trip takes 5 to 10 minutes, and the boats pictured, although the actual Regatta boats, are very similar to the ones actually used for passengers crossing the harbour.

    Crossings usually start from the Vittoriosa side, but should you require the reverse trip, you may ask the tender to pick you up at a given time, to give you his phone number, or alternatively try to capture his attention from across the harbour, by waving or shouting (seriously - I did this myself).

    At Senglea, you will land at the waterfront, very near the Azopardo Bust (see separate entry).

    Transportation: Around Senglea On Foot

    Getting TO/AROUND: At less than a mile at its two farthest points, Senglea is very easily covered on foot. Apart from the small distances to be covered, the places of interest are not that far from each other, and the effort will be even smaller, since you will probably be pausing after very short distances...

    Unfortunately, some parts of the city, however, may not be completely accessible to wheelchair users or pushchairs.
